Overview
Helicobacter pylori Selective Medium Base is a specialised culture medium for the isolation and cultivation of Helicobacter pylori, a microaerophilic Gram-negative spiral bacterium and the primary causative agent of chronic active gastritis, peptic ulcer disease, and gastric adenocarcinoma. Classified as an IARC Group I carcinogen, H. pylori colonises the human gastric mucosa and requires enriched, highly selective conditions for successful primary isolation.
The base medium is Columbia Blood Agar supplemented with 5–10% defibrinated sheep blood (providing haemin, NAD, and growth factors) and a four-antibiotic selective cocktail: vancomycin (Gram-positive suppression), trimethoprim (enteric flora), cefsulodin (anti-Pseudomonas), and amphotericin B (antifungal). H. pylori is intrinsically resistant to all four antibiotics at concentrations used, permitting preferential recovery from complex clinical specimens.

Selective Antibiotic Supplement (VCTA)
Vancomycin
Suppresses Gram-positive bacteria
~10 mg/L · Glycopeptide · Cell wall inhibition
Trimethoprim
Suppresses enteric Gram-negative bacilli
~5 mg/L · DHFR inhibitor · Folate pathway
Cefsulodin
Inhibits Pseudomonas aeruginosa
~5 mg/L · Beta-lactam · Cell wall inhibition
Amphotericin B
Inhibits yeasts and moulds
~2 mg/L · Polyene · Ergosterol binding
H. pylori is intrinsically resistant to all four antibiotics at concentrations used, enabling highly selective recovery from heavily contaminated gastric specimens.
Colony Identification & Confirmation
Colony morphology
Small (0.5–2 mm), circular, convex, translucent to grey, smooth; non-haemolytic (gamma)
Urease test
Strongly positive — rapid urease colour change within 1–4 hours
Oxidase test
Positive
Catalase test
Positive
Gram stain
Gram-negative spiral / curved rods; S-shaped or seagull morphology
Motility
Positive — corkscrew motility by dark-field or phase-contrast microscopy
Molecular confirmation
16S rRNA PCR or species-specific PCR for definitive identification
High humidity essential — prevent desiccation Use CampyPak or equivalent gas generator
Aerobic and anaerobic conditions are NOT suitable — H. pylori requires strict microaerophilic atmosphere for growth. Standard CO² incubators are insufficient without O² control.
